Bug 22985 - при создании i586-wine-vanilla вырезает нужное
: при создании i586-wine-vanilla вырезает нужное
Status: CLOSED FIXED
: Sisyphus
(All bugs in Sisyphus/arepo)
: unstable
: all Linux
: P3 normal
Assigned To:
:
:
:
:
: 22984
  Show dependency tree
 
Reported: 2010-02-18 00:19 by
Modified: 2010-03-08 22:53 (History)


Attachments


Note

You need to log in before you can comment on or make changes to this bug.


Description From 2010-02-18 00:19:27
При AREPO-ании wine-vanilla убирает из него /usr/bin/*, после чего тот
становиться неработоспособен. Нужно сделать, чтоб тупо перепаковывал в
i586-wine-vanilla и ставил конфликт на wine-vanilla.

Может, это возможно ли сделать это как-то в конфиге?
------- Comment #1 From 2010-02-18 08:06:50 -------
В конфиге -- никак нельзя сделать, надо поправить соответствующее место в коде,
чтобы работали хаки {before,after,replace}_files. На неделе сделаю.
------- Comment #2 From 2010-02-24 00:43:07 -------
Короче, чо я придумал. Давайте у нас будут "библиотеки" и "программы".
"Библиотеки" мы будем перепаковывать как раньше, а "программы" — как требуется
по условиям этой баги.

Соответственно, пишем
libraries: >
   ...
   libwine-vanilla
programs: >
   wine-vanilla

Вместо libraries можно, как раньше, писать packages -- для совместимости.

Реализация у меня в гите. i586-wine-vanilla вроде бы собрался как надо.
------- Comment #3 From 2010-03-01 13:25:08 -------
Дим! А ты пользуешься пакетным или из git?
------- Comment #4 From 2010-03-08 22:53:37 -------
(В ответ на комментарий №2)
> Реализация у меня в гите.
Проверил, работает.